The Vaccines have been announced as the third headline act for this year’s Liverpool Sound City. The indie rockers will join previously announced headliners The Flaming Lips and Belle and Sebastian at the three day event, which will be held on May 22, 23 and 24. The London band recently previewed their new single, Handsome, and […]
